One of California's fastest growing cities lies in the heart of the San Joaquin Valley (part of California's Great Central Valley). It's one hour east of the San Francisco Bay Area and an hour south of Sacramento, California's state capital. The city is Manteca, with projected populations of 64,342 for 2006 and 74,982 by 2010.
Historically, Manteca's popularity has been influenced primarily by agribusiness thanks to the area's rich soil, temperate climate and reasonably priced water. Manteca's rural lifestyle, abundant recreational opportunities, appealing quality of life, and proximity to colleges and universities in Stockton, Modesto, Lathrop and Merced are icing on the cake. Recently, the city has also become a magnet for electronic firms as well as industrial and commercial businesses eager to find lower operating costs, quality of life amenities and easy access to all modes of transportation - three things Manteca offers in abundance.
